Re: How do I downgrade my firmware?
The earliest firmware you can download is 1.6.53, AFIK they never had the factory installed 1.6.04 up for download.
And currently YouTube and other websites are switching/have switched to flash 10.1. Archos hasn't had time to compile the flash 10.1 package yet, (if ever) since it was only released for mobile CPUs this year. In the mean time you can use http://www.youtube.com/xl it is meant for web capable TVs, but IMHO it looks better on the A5 compared to the normal YouTube.
